And as subtle as it maybe...... there is nothing like shooting from the 
"SHADOW SIDE" to add form to the face. Some folks think when I say "shoot 
from the shadow side" that I mean the dark shadow created by the noon day 
sun.. That can at times be a total disaster with humans.

More often than not the shadow side is there as seen in ths subtle light 
situation where it's so gentle and form enhancing as it does here .
